WebMay 5, 2024 · On the 'Create Pull Request' page and the 'Compare Branch' page Bitbucket Server shows a 'common ancestor' diff (also known as a 2-way diff). WebApr 28, 2024 · 1. Create a pull request to merge changes from production branch to the master branch. 2. Auto approve the pull request. 3. Auto-merge the pull request from production branch to master branch. 4. Send email to predefined BitBucket Admin user, if any of the previous steps failed.
